Hi, I use Dvorak keyboard layout, and have already added kbd Option in xorg.conf, and everything work fine with programs run in the X environment.
When I compose my own .fvwmrc for Fvwm, I defined some key bindings for it, say: Key F A C GoToPage 1 1 Key D A C GoToPage 0 0 After startx, the GoToPage actions were bound to Ctrl-F and Ctrl-D in QWERTY layout (which are Ctrl-E and Ctrl-U in Dvorak, or the 3rd and 4th keys in the middle line), so I began to think all those bindings are parsed as in QWERTY layout. But after I restarted the fvwm (by typing restart in FvwmTalk), things changed, it began to interpret the configurations in Dvorak layout, that is, Ctrl-F and Ctrl-D in Dvorak layout, which are Ctrl-Y and Ctrl-H in QWERTY, started to turn the page. Is that a bug of Fvwm? Is anybody encountered this problem before? Thanks! Bruce
